About The Role

MASSAGE THERAPY SPECIALIST

Berkeley Hall Club is seeking a Massage Therapy Specialist on a contract-basis to perform the Scope of Services listed below.

Club Description

Berkeley Hall Club, a distinctive private golf community edged on the banks of the pristine Okatie River in Bluffton, South Carolina – the heart of the coastal Lowcountry – a world with a casually inviting and active lifestyle that sets the standard for all private communities. Just minutes from Hilton Head Island, our 980-acre property is unique among top private golf communities. With two world-class Tom Fazio courses and a stunning Jeffersonian-style clubhouse that form the “Core of the Community,” our two walkable classic courses feel more like a golf retreat, with beautiful lagoons and majestic live oaks.

Scope of Services

  • Provide spa, esthetician, and massage services to members and guests.
  • Utilize industry knowledge, expertise, and education to create, develop and consistently update member spa services and offerings.
  • Provide members and guests with timely and efficient service(s).
  • Continually inspect treatment rooms for organization and cleanliness.
  • Clean wet areas as necessary pre- and post-spa service appointment.
  • Perform other services as requested by Director of Wellness.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ent required.
  • Bachelor’s Degree in a Health Sciences, Exercise Science or related field is a plus.
  • Exceptional spa program and spa services acumen and good customer service skills.
  • Experience working in an upscale fitness center, spa, country club, or hospitality environment is preferred.
  • Attention to detail with emphasis on accuracy and quality.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.

Preferred Certification/License

  • Certification in First Aid, CPR/AED
  • Current Licensed Massage Therapist for the State of South Carolina
  • Pay: Commission structure on spa services performed
  • Schedule: Flexible with hours ranging from 8am to 5pm
